

From September 1, 2026, imported concrete pump trucks, tower cranes, and mobile cranes entering Brazil face a new compliance condition tied to type approval. The change comes after INMETRO issued Portaria No. 142/2026 on July 11, 2026, requiring these imported machines to be pre-integrated with an IoT remote monitoring module compliant with ABNT NBR 15603-2 and to pass functional verification at an INMETRO-authorized laboratory. For equipment suppliers, importers, certification teams, and procurement functions, this is worth close attention because it shifts the compliance checkpoint forward into product configuration, testing, and delivery planning.
According to the information provided, INMETRO published Portaria No. 142/2026 on July 11, 2026. The measure applies to imported concrete pump trucks, tower cranes, and mobile cranes destined for Brazil. Starting on September 1, 2026, those products must be pre-integrated with an IoT remote monitoring module that complies with ABNT NBR 15603-2. The module must also undergo functional verification by an INMETRO-authorized laboratory. Equipment without the module will not receive type approval.
